Warranty
- Roofing: Asphalt roofing systems carry a 30-year limited lifetime warranty; Metal roofing systems carry a 50-year limited lifetime transferable warranty
- Waterproofing: Erie Home offers full basement solutions backed by a 25-year limited lifetime warranty.

Once this has been completed – tentatively on 20251126, I will make final comments. ************************************************************* ORIGINAL GOOGLE REVIEW: Communications were very poor during the entire process with Erie Home. I had to call multiple times to see what the plan/process was. Certain questions were skipped over and assigned to different people. What I can gather, the Columbus office took on the job but had no staff to complete, so the Cincinnati office got the “installation” job, but that is all they were responsible for. The Columbus office did not pick up all of the items that were stated in the sales process and now there is no way I can be “satisfied” in how this process occurred. Sales contract stated to be complete by end of September 2025, but was completed on November 10th 2025. Process/down payment started on August 6th, 2025. Pro's - The installation itself went smooth once it started. Workers kept areas clean and picked up their items each end of days work. Professional interactions. Electrical contractor hired by Erie to supply electric to their sump pumps and air handler systems was good but was completed after Erie work was done. Con's - Poor communications except by installation team - they went over each day's work with me. No planning was made until the installation started itself. Some items that were indicated to happen with sales team were not how the actual installation went; a) there is no wireless/Bluetooth monitoring of systems installed. b) discharge of water was not put in an existing pump discharge pipe due their warranty. Warranty - READ Warranty and understand what the warranty says. Sales team indicated all problems were warrantied for 25 years. But not replacement batteries for systems, "manufacturing warranty" in effect (1 year), $125 fee for each warranty call, etc. Due to the high cost of this 2000 sq foot crawl space encapsulation, I would have thought the communications, employee leadership, and warranty would be better. Just read everything before signing/monies and have all written in the contract itself. 1st photo shows the crew arriving on 3rd day of install.
